Since the G-Tech is dependant on an acclerometer, it is...
critical that it is zeroed out on a LEVEL surface. The weight input has nothing to do with how it calculates its accelration values. That only impacts the HP calculations.
I was able to get repeatability on 5 consecutive runs with mine of .1". My best time with my current mods was 4.9" for 0-60.
